Slightly Stoopid

Southern California’s SLIGHTLY STOOPID put on a smokin’ performance last night as part of the Summer Haze tour with co-headliner G. Love and Special Sauce. The band blazed through a set that was a nice mix of songs off their recently released Chronchitis and a mix of fan favorites. Fortunately a high percentage of the audience had lighters which lit up the night sky at Central Park during the slow jams.
